B站视频下载工具:解锁大会员4K与充电专属视频的专业解决方案

发布时间:2026/7/5 5:45:07
B站视频下载工具:解锁大会员4K与充电专属视频的专业解决方案 B站视频下载工具解锁大会员4K与充电专属视频的专业解决方案【免费下载链接】bilibili-downloaderB站视频下载支持下载大会员清晰度4K持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ader你是否曾遇到过这样的困境在B站上发现一个精彩的教程视频想要离线保存却无从下手作为大会员明明购买了4K高清权限却只能在有网络时观看或者看到UP主的充电专属视频想要收藏却受限于平台限制今天我将为你介绍一款专业的B站视频下载工具它不仅能够突破平台限制还能让你轻松获取大会员4K高清内容和充电专属视频打造属于你的离线视频库。 痛点分析为什么我们需要专业的B站视频下载工具平台限制带来的三大挑战场景一学习资源无法离线保存作为一名学习者你可能经常在B站上发现优质的编程教程、设计课程或语言学习视频。然而当你身处地铁、高铁或网络信号不佳的环境时这些宝贵的学习资源却无法访问。传统的收藏功能只能保存链接无法真正拥有内容。场景二大会员权益无法充分享受作为B站大会员你支付了年费理应享受4K高清画质的观看体验。但现实是一旦网络环境不佳或需要出差旅行这些高清内容就成了摆设。平台不提供官方下载功能让你的会员权益大打折扣。场景三充电专属内容难以收藏许多优质UP主会发布充电专属视频这些内容往往质量极高值得反复观看。然而每次观看都需要重新加载既消耗流量又浪费时间。你需要的是一种能够永久保存这些珍贵内容的方式。 解决方案Python驱动的专业下载工具工具核心特性一览这款基于Python开发的B站视频下载工具通过巧妙的技术方案解决了上述所有问题大会员内容一键下载通过Cookie认证直接获取大会员权限的4K高清视频充电视频轻松保存绕过平台限制下载需要充电才能观看的独家内容智能批量处理支持批量添加视频链接自动按顺序下载效率提升300%分P视频智能管理自动识别多章节视频结构支持选择性下载特定分P进度可视化显示实时显示下载进度和速度操作过程完全透明技术架构解析项目的代码结构清晰采用模块化设计便于理解和维护 bilibili-downloader/ ├── models/ # 数据模型定义 │ ├── category.py # 视频分类模型 │ └── video.py # 视频信息模型 ├── strategy/ # 下载策略实现 │ ├── bilibili_executor.py # 主要执行器 │ ├── bilibili_strategy.py # 策略接口 │ ├── bangumi.py # 番剧处理 │ └── default.py # 默认策略 ├── config.py # 配置文件 └── main.py # 主程序入口这种设计让工具具备了良好的扩展性未来可以轻松添加新的视频源支持。 实战演示三步完成视频下载第一步环境准备与安装确保你的电脑已安装Python 3.8或更高版本然后执行以下命令git clone https://gitcode.com/gh_mirrors/bil/bilibili-downloader cd bilibili-downloader pip install -r requirements.txt安装过程只需几分钟依赖库包括httpx异步HTTP客户端提供高效的网络请求beautifulsoup4HTML解析库用于提取视频信息moviepy视频处理库用于合并音视频tqdm进度条显示提供良好的用户体验第二步配置B站账号Cookie这是下载大会员和充电视频的关键步骤。Cookie相当于你的数字身份证告诉B站服务器你的会员身份使用Chrome或Edge浏览器登录你的B站账号打开任意视频页面按F12打开开发者工具切换到网络标签页刷新页面点击第一个请求在请求头中找到Cookie字段复制整个Cookie字符串到config.py文件中图示在开发者工具中找到Cookie字段并复制SESSDATA值第三步添加视频链接并开始下载编辑config.py文件在URL列表中添加你想下载的视频链接# 下载视频的URL列表 URL [ # 普通视频示例 https://www.bilibili.com/video/BV1xx123456, # 分P视频指定第2集 https://www.bilibili.com/video/BV1xx654321?p2, # 充电专属视频 https://www.bilibili.com/video/BV1xx789012, ]配置完成后运行python main.py即可开始下载。工具会自动处理视频和音频的分离下载然后合并成完整的MP4文件。图示工具运行时的进度显示和效果展示 应用案例不同用户的实际使用场景学生党建立个人学习资料库用户画像计算机专业大学生小李需求收藏B站上的Python教程和算法课程解决方案按学科创建文件夹Python基础、数据结构、机器学习使用分P视频功能下载完整系列课程每周花15分钟整理新收藏的学习资源效果半年时间建立了包含200小时视频的个人学习库内容创作者灵感素材收集系统用户画像视频UP主小王需求收集参考视频和创意素材解决方案批量下载同类视频进行对比分析建立标签系统剪辑技巧、转场效果、调色参考定期整理素材库删除过时内容效果创作效率提升40%视频质量明显提高普通观众娱乐内容离线收藏用户画像上班族小张需求通勤路上观看喜欢的UP主视频解决方案每周日晚批量下载下一周想看的视频按UP主分类科技区、生活区、游戏区使用NAS存储多设备同步观看效果每天通勤时间有效利用网络流量节省80% 进阶技巧提升下载效率的实用方法批量下载策略优化对于需要下载大量视频的用户可以采用以下策略# 批量下载示例下载UP主的所有视频 up主视频列表 [ https://www.bilibili.com/video/BV1xx111111, https://www.bilibili.com/video/BV1xx222222, https://www.bilibili.com/video/BV1xx333333, # ... 更多视频链接 ] # 在config.py中一次性添加所有链接 URL up主视频列表工具支持并发下载默认同时处理2个视频避免对B站服务器造成过大压力。自定义下载目录管理在config.py中你可以自定义文件保存位置import os # 程序根目录请勿修改 BASE_PATH os.path.dirname(os.path.abspath(__file__)) # 文件临时输出目录 TEMP_PATH os.path.join(BASE_PATH, temp) # 视频输出目录 OUTPUT_PATH os.path.join(BASE_PATH, output)你可以将这些路径修改为你喜欢的任何位置比如外接硬盘/Volumes/External/VideoLibrary/NAS存储/mnt/nas/B站视频/云同步目录~/OneDrive/B站下载/智能错误处理机制工具内置了完善的错误处理机制自动记录下载失败的视频链接到failed_urls.txt网络中断后支持断点续传Cookie过期时会有明确提示存储空间不足时提前预警⚠️ 常见误区与避坑指南误区一Cookie永久有效实际情况B站的SESSDATA大约30天会失效正确做法设置日历提醒每月检查一次Cookie状态解决方案创建自动化脚本每月提醒更新Cookie误区二下载速度越快越好实际情况过快的下载速度可能触发B站的反爬机制正确做法保持合理的下载间隔避免短时间内大量请求解决方案使用工具的并发限制功能默认设置为2个同时下载误区三所有视频都能下载实际情况部分番剧和电影需要中国大陆IP才能访问正确做法了解工具的限制合理规划下载内容解决方案对于需要特殊权限的内容配合网络工具使用误区四下载的视频无法播放常见原因播放器不支持视频编码格式下载过程中出现错误视频文件损坏解决方案安装VLC、PotPlayer等全能播放器重新下载问题视频检查存储设备是否有坏道 未来展望工具的发展方向功能增强计划基于当前的项目架构未来可以扩展以下功能智能分类系统基于视频内容自动分类和打标签字幕自动下载支持多语言字幕的同步下载封面图提取自动保存视频封面作为缩略图元数据管理完善视频的标题、UP主、发布时间等信息跨平台支持开发Windows、macOS、Linux的图形界面版本社区生态建设开源项目的生命力在于社区未来可以建立用户交流群分享使用技巧和问题解决方案创建插件系统允许开发者扩展新功能编写详细文档降低新用户的学习门槛定期更新维护适配B站接口的变化最佳实践建议合理使用原则尊重版权仅用于个人学习和研究目的遵守协议遵守B站用户协议和版权方的权益空间管理根据存储空间合理选择视频画质定期备份将配置好的config.py备份方便在不同设备间迁移实用小贴士创建下载清单将想下载的视频链接整理到文本文件中定期更新Cookie设置提醒每月检查一次Cookie状态关注项目更新定期检查是否有新版本发布 开始你的离线观看之旅现在你已经掌握了使用这款B站视频下载工具的所有技巧。无论你是想要保存喜欢的UP主作品还是下载大会员专属的4K高清视频甚至是充电才能观看的独家内容这个工具都能满足你的需求。记住工具虽好但请合理使用尊重创作者的劳动成果让优质内容能够持续产生。开始你的离线观看之旅享受随时随地观看B站视频的自由吧如果你在使用过程中遇到任何问题或者有功能建议欢迎在项目页面提交反馈。让我们一起让这个工具变得更好为更多用户提供优质的B站视频下载体验【免费下载链接】bilibili-downloaderB站视频下载支持下载大会员清晰度4K持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考